How to Cook a Pot Pie in the Air Fryer
Cooking a pot pie in the air fryer is simple and straightforward. Here’s how to do it:
- Preheat your air fryer to 375°F.
- Remove the pot pie from its packaging and discard the plastic wrap.
- Place the pot pie in the air fryer basket.
- Cook the pot pie for 15-20 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the filling is heated through.
- Carefully remove the pot pie from the air fryer basket and let it cool for a few minutes before serving.

Tips and Tricks for Cooking a Pot Pie in the Air Fryer
To ensure your pot pie comes out perfectly every time, follow these tips and tricks:
- If your pot pie has a top crust, brush it with an egg wash before cooking to give it a golden brown color.
- Don’t overcrowd the air fryer basket. Only cook one pot pie at a time to ensure even cooking.
- Let the pot pie cool for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the filling to set and prevent it from spilling out when you cut into it.
- Use a meat thermometer to ensure the filling re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.

Q: Can you cook a frozen pot pie in the air fryer?
A: Yes, you can definitely cook a frozen pot pie in the air fryer. In fact, cooking a frozen pot pie in the air fryer is a quick and convenient way to have a delicious meal in no time. The air fryer’s hot circulating air cooks the pot pie evenly, producing a crispy crust and piping hot filling.
To cook a frozen pot pie in the air fryer, you will first need to preheat the air fryer to 350°F. Once the air fryer has preheated, remove the pot pie from its packaging and place it in the air fryer basket.
Cook the pot pie for 15-20 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the filling is hot and bubbly. Keep in mind that cooking times may vary depending on the brand and size of the pot pie, so it’s always a good idea to check the manufacturer’s instructions for specific cooking times and temperatures.
